    Microsoft is refusing to refund back Skype credit, according to user

    March 25, 2025

    As you may all know already, Microsoft will be retiring the Skype app in May, and all of those who still renewed their subscriptions or purchased Skype credit are advised to use it before the deadline. However, for those who want a refund, it might not be possible at all, according to the experience of […]
